Harrison EASTBURN Obituary

Harrison L. Eastburn Age 71 of Phoenixville, PA passed away on Tuesday, October 1, 2002 at his residence. He was born and raised in Wyncote, PA on January 1, 1931 to the late Mortimer N. Eastburn and Mary M. (nee McEvoy) Eastburn. Prior to moving to Phoenixville, he also lived in North Carolina and Havertown, PA. He attended Germantown Academy, University of Pennsylvania and University of Pennsylvania Law School. He was a member of the University of Pennsylvania Alumni Association. Mr. Eastburn was an attorney for Suburban Abstract Title Insurance and retired in the mid 90's. He is preceded in death by his late wife, Mary Louise (nee Lane) Eastburn to whom he was married 44 years at the time of her death in 2001. He is survived by his children, Mary Ellen Gardner of Drexel Hill, PA, Matthew Eastburn of Newark, DE and Grant Eastburn of East Lansdowne, PA; 7 grandchildren; and a brother Mortimer Eastburn of NC. He was a devoted father, grandfather and loved his dog. A memorial mass will be held on Monday, October 7 at 10 am at the St. Cyril Church, Penn Blvd., East Lansdowne, PA. Burial will be in SS Peter & Paul Cemetery, Springfield, PA. The family suggest donations be made to the American Cancer Society, 600 N. Jackson St., Media, PA 19063.
